Significance: The Square Tower Group is one of six ruin complexes that together comprise the Hovenweep National Monument, an entity established in 1923 based on the recognition of the pre European Pueblo Culture and on the significance of its stone masonry. The complex built at the head of Little Ruin Canyon on Cajon Mesa took its name from the Square Tower located on the canyon bottom. Surrounding the canyonhead are Hovenweep Castle and Hovenweep House.
